Sarah Fitz-Claridge

Sarah Fitz-Claridge (formerly Sarah Lawrence), founder of the world-wide parenting movement and educational philosophy, Taking Children Seriously (TCS), is a writer and speaker. She edits Taking Children Seriously, the eponymous journal, and runs internet lists and a website associated with TCS. She describes herself as a fallibilist, rationalist, Popperian, libertarian, and an autonomist.
